Overview The Silicon Valley Clean Energy Authority ( SVCEA ) is seeking proposals for data management and customer service support functions necessary to operate the Silicon Valley Clean Energy ( SVCE ) Community Choice Aggregation Program ( CCA Program or Program ). This Program will serve residential and commercial customers located within Santa Clara County. Through the SVCE Program, the SVCEA will provide two distinct retail service offerings to participating customers. The default service option will include a renewable energy content that exceeds the minimum procurement requirements established under California s Renewables Portfolio Standard ( RPS ) program, supplemented with large hydroelectric energy to provide a zero or very low carbon energy content. The retail generation rates associated with the default service option are expected to be below the tariffs charged by the incumbent electric utility, Pacific Gas and Electric ( PG&E ). A voluntary service option with a 100% renewable energy content will be made available to interested SVCE customers at a modest premium to the SVCE default tariff. Through this Request for Proposals process ( RFP ), SVCEA is seeking proposals for: (1) managing SVCE customer account data; (2) exchanging customer usage, billing and payment data with PG&E; (3) responding to SVCE customer service calls; and (4) addressing SVCE customer service issues. At full enrollment, peak demand for the SVCE Program is projected to be approximately 685 MW; annual energy requirements are projected to be approximately 3,400 GWh; and SVCE s retail service accounts are expected to total approximately 210,000. The aforementioned projections are based on an assumption that 15% of prospective SVCE customers will opt- out of (i.e., not participate in) the Program, electing to continue bundled service with PG&E instead. The SVCEA anticipates enrolling prospective SVCE customers in three phases: Phase 1 (April 2017): all municipal accounts, all small and medium commercial accounts, 20 percent of residential accounts, and all customer accounts that have voluntarily expressed interest in Phase 1 enrollment. Phase 2 (July 2017): all large commercial and industrial accounts as well as 35 percent of residential accounts. Phase 3 (October 2017): all agricultural and street lighting accounts as well as the remaining 45 percent of residential accounts. Silicon Valley Clean Energy Authority Background Beginning in 2014, the Silicon Valley Community Choice Energy ( SVCCE ) Partnership, which included the Cities of Cupertino, Mountain View, and Sunnyvale as well as the County of Santa Clara, began investigating formation of a CCA Program in the County, pursuant to California state law, with the following objectives: 1) provide cost- competitive electric services; 2) reduce GHG emissions related to the use of electric power within the County; and 3) increase the use of renewable energy resources relative to the incumbent utility. Thereafter, eight additional communities (City of Campbell, City of Gilroy, City of Los Altos, Town of Los Altos Hills, Town of Los Gatos, City of Monte Sereno, City of Morgan Hill, and City of Saratoga) within the County joined the SVCCE Partnership, increasing the Partnership to twelve communities, which comprise SVCEA s current membership. A technical feasibility study for a CCA Program was completed for the SVCCE Partnership in April In March 2016, SVCEA was formed, as a joint powers authority, for purposes of implementing the SVCE Program. On July 13, 2016, the SVCEA Board of Directors adopted the Implementation Plan. On July 14, the plan was submitted to the CPUC for certification, which is expected to occur before or by mid- October The Implementation Plan and other information regarding SVCE can be found As described in the Implementation Plan and consistent with the laws and regulations governing CCAs, all current PG&E electric customers within SVCEA s jurisdictional boundaries will be automatically enrolled in the CCA Program and served by SVCE, except for those customers who affirmatively elect to opt- out of the CCA Program and remain bundled SVCE RFP for Data Management and Call Center 2

5 service customers of PG&E. Following SVCE service commencement, PG&E will continue to provide distribution, metering and billing services to SVCE customers. SVCEA expects that retail rates associated with the standard/default service option will be competitive with similar rates charged by PG&E. Rates associated with the voluntary 100% renewable energy service option may exceed comparable rates charged by PG&E in consideration of actual renewable energy procurement costs that will be incurred to support participating customers. The requested services under this solicitation are described below. D. Scope of Work 1. Electronic Data Exchange Services a. Process CCA Service Requests (CCASRs) from/to PG&E which specify the changes to a customer'ʹs choice of services such as enrollment in CCA programs, customer initiated returns to bundled utility service or customer initiated returns to direct access service (814 Electronic Data Interchange Files). b. Obtain all customer usage data, including hourly interval usage data at billing level quality, from PG&E'ʹs Metered Data Management Agent (MDMA) server to allow for timely billing (according to PG&E requirements) of each customer (867 Electronic Data Interchange Files). c. Maintain and communicate the amount to be billed by PG&E for services provided by SVCE (810 Electronic Data Interchange Files). d. Receive and maintain all data related to payment transactions toward CCA charges from PG&E after payment is received by PG&E from customers (820 Electronic Data Interchange Files). e. Provider shall participate in the Customer Data Acquisition Program (CDA) beta testing for SmartMeter data sharing as SVCE'ʹs Data Manager. f. If Provider is not able to obtain customer usage data that would allow SVCEA to bill customers using generation rate structures (E.g., time of use periods) that are different from those reflected in the applicable PG&E delivery rate schedule, Provider shall explain in detail why this service cannot be provided and shall propose a solution that would resolve this deficiency within one year. 2. Qualified Reporting Entity ( QRE ) Services a. Consistent with terms and conditions included in the Qualified Reporting Entity Services Agreement(s) between SVCE and Data Management Provider, serve as QRE for certain locally situated, small- scale renewable generators supplying electric energy to SVCE through its feed- in tariff (FIT). b. Submit a monthly generation extract file to Western Renewable Energy Generation Information System (WREGIS) on SVCE s behalf, which will SVCE RFP for Data Management and Call Center 3

6 conform to the characteristics and data requirements set forth in the WREGIS Interface Control Document for Qualified Reporting Entities. c. Provider shall receive applicable electric meter data from PG&E for SVCE FIT projects, consistent with PG&E s applicable meter servicing agreement, and shall provide such data to SVCE for purposes of performance tracking and invoice creation. 3. Customer Information System a. Establish an operational Customer Relationship Management System within 30 days of contract execution, and establish an operational Customer Information System within 60 days of contract execution. b. Maintain an accurate database of all eligible accounts who are located in the SVCE service area and identify each account s enrollment status (opt out, program enrollment), rate tariff election(s), payment history, collection status, on- site generating capacity, if applicable, and any correspondence with customer as well as other information that may become necessary to effectively administer SVCE as mutually agreed to by parties from time to time. c. Allow SVCE to have functional access to the online database to add customer interactions and other account notes. d. Allow SVCE to view customer or written letter correspondence within online database. e. Maintain and provide as- needed historical usage data on all customers for a time period equal to the lesser of either (a) the start of customer service to present or (b) five years. f. Until a cloud- based storage solutions for SmartMeter historical usage data is implemented, Provider will store SmartMeter historical usage data, as received by the MDMA, for a 48 hour window. g. Maintain viewing access, available to appropriate SVCE staff, to view PG&E bills for SVCE customers, including supporting the intuitive parsing and labeling of PG&E provided files. Maintain accessible archive of billing records for all SVCE customers from the start of SVCE Service or a period of no less than five years. h. Maintain and communicate as needed record of customers who have been offered service with SVCE but have elected to opt out, either before or after starting service with SVCE. i. Maintain and communicate as needed records of Net Energy Metering credits and generation data for customers to be posted on bill and settled at least annually. j. When requested by SVCE, place program charges on the relevant customer account, identified by Service Agreement ID (SAID). k. Identify customers participating in various SVCE programs in database. l. Include various program payment information in all relevant reports. SVCE RFP for Data Management and Call Center 4

7 m. Perform quarterly SVCE program reviews to assess appropriate customer charge level. n. Maintain all customer data according to SVCE s customer privacy policy and the requirements of relevant California Public Utilities Commission Decisions including D , including a daily backup process. o. Maintain a Data Management Provider Security Breach Policy. 4. Customer Call Center a. Provide professional Interactive Voice Response (IVR) recordings for CCA customer call center. b. Provide option for IVR self- service and track how many customers start and complete self- service options without live- agent assistance. c. Staff a call center, during any CCA Statutory Enrollment Period, 24 hours a day 7 days a week to process opt out requests. d. Staff a call center during Non- Enrollment Period between the hours of 8 AM and 5 PM PPT Monday through Friday, excluding SVCE and PG&E holidays. e. Provide sufficient call center staffing to meet the requirements set forth herein, including designating SVCE specific agents to the extent needed to provide for full functionality and a call center supervisor that will serve as the main point of contact between SVCE and the customer call center staff. f. Provide sufficient number of Data Manager Experts available to manage escalated calls between the hours of 8 AM and 5 PM PPT Monday through Friday, excluding SVCE and PG&E holidays ( Regular Business Hours ). g. Adhere to the following performance standards during Non- enrollment Periods: i. A minimum of 75% of all calls will be answered within 20 seconds. ii. A minimum of 98% of all calls will be answered within 3 minutes. iii. 100% of voic messages answered within one (1) business day. iv. 100% of s receive an immediate automated acknowledgement. v. 95% of s receive a customized response within one (1) business day. vi. 100% of s receive a customized response within three (3) business days. vii. Achieve a no greater than 5% abandon rate for all calls. h. Adhere to the following performance standards during Enrollment Periods: i. A minimum of 75% of all calls will be answered within 60 seconds. ii. A minimum of 95% of all calls will be answered within 3 minutes. iii. 100% of voic messages answered within one (1) business day. iv. 100% of s receive an immediate automated acknowledgement. v. 95% of s receive a customized response within one (1) business day. vi. 100% of s receive a customized response within three (3) business days. vii. Achieve a no greater than 10% abandon rate for all calls. SVCE RFP for Data Management and Call Center 5

8 i. Provide monthly reports that demonstrate whether performance standards have been met. Failure to meet performance standards will result in liquidated damages for which Provider shall be liable. j. Provide callers with the estimated hold time, if applicable. Provide an automated call back option for callers who will be put on hold for an estimated five minutes or longer. k. Record all inbound calls and make recordings available to SVCE staff upon request. Maintain an archive of such recorded calls for a minimum period of 24 months. l.
